Within this 2-hour workshop, Rafael will detail one of his personal techniques: Liquify Extravaganza. It uses the Liquify tool in Procreate to allow artists to create many textures, visual artifacts, and intentional accidents, which he then uses to “sculpt” specific shapes and forms into the illustration. This technique will greatly help students with their own explorations.

In this lesson, Rafael demonstrates the ‘Liquify extravaganza’ technique: an experimental approach to digital texture creation that transforms destructive pixel manipulation into a creative advantage. By treating distorted layers as raw material to be manipulated and rearranged rather than final effects, he creates rich details and patterns that enhance illustrations with authentic-feeling textures and design elements.
